The name of the AEW trio of Kenny Omega, Kota Ibushi and Chris Jericho has seemingly been revealed.
At tomorrow night’s AEW WrestleDream event, Chris Jericho is set to team up with Kenny Omega and Kota Ibushi to take on the Don Callis Family’s Konosuke Takeshita, Sammy Guevara and Will Ospreay.
Many variations of the Elite have different group names, including the Golden Elite, which features Ibushi alongside Omega, the Bucks and Hangman Page.
Well, we may now know what the Omega, Ibushi and Jericho trio will be known as, thanks to a new trademark filing from Chris Jericho.
Per the United States Patent & Trademark Office, Jericho filed to trademark the term ‘the Golden Jets’ on September 29, which would make sense as the trios name given the inclusion of the term ‘Golden’.
The following description accompanied the filing:
